Sipping a Cloud is a powerful exploration of what it means to exist in this moment and what binds us together in Beloved Community. Whether the speaker is sharing family history or following the assured steps of her own two feet, each page is an intimate conversation with a dear friend. Through contemplation and a search for beauty, Kathy Kremins invites us on a journey to find our own version of "sipping a cloud."

Notă biografică
Kathy Kremins is a poet, photographer, and independent scholar. She is a retired NJ public school teacher and coach and holds a doctorate from Drew University. She has three poetry chapbooks: Unrehearsed with Toma Zbrizher (Two Key Customs, 2025), Seamus & His Smalls (Two Key Customs, 2023), and Undressing the World (Finishing Line Press, 2022). Her first full-length book of poetry, The Curve of Things, was published by CavanKerry Press in May 2024. Her second collection, Sipping a Cloud, is available from Read Furiously. She is the author of The Ethics of Reading: The Broken Beauties of Toni Morrison, Arundhati Roy, and Nawal el Sadaawi (2010) and an essay contributor to Too Smart to be Sentimental: Contemporary Irish American Women Writers (2008). She is also an editor for NJ Audubon Magazine.
